int ptrace(int request, int pid, int
addr, int data);
request: [in] the kind of request.
pid: [in] target task.
addr: [in] the address where to perform peek and poke operations.
data: [in] the data to write for poke operations and [out] the data read for peek operations.
This call is used for debugging a child of the current task. The traced child
will run until a signal occurs. The parent is notified through the
wait syscall. When the child is stoped the content of its address
space may be read and written by the parent. The request parameter
may be one of the following:

On success zero is returned. On error -1 is returned and errno
is set to one of the following values:
EPERM: the target taks cannot be traced or is already being
traced.
ESRCH, EIO.
